The term “False Break” has become a lifeline in discussions about Bitcoin’s price behavior, as noted by Trader Tardigrade, a crypto analyst active on like X (formerly Twitter). The notion of a False Break posits that Bitcoin’s temporary drop below the supportive boundary of the Ascending Channel does not necessarily indicate a sustained downtrend. Instead, it suggests a momentary bearish sentiment that, if corrected, may reassure investors about Bitcoin’s for recovery.

Trader Tardigrade’s chart analysis highlights the significance of the Ascending Channel’s support line. After a pronounced decline, Bitcoin’s prompt return to this channel indicates that the supporting structure remains intact. The implications of this behavior suggest that Bitcoin has not definitively broken away from its bullish pattern—a prospect that could be interpreted as encouraging for traders willing to take risks. If Bitcoin successfully retests and remains above this support level, analysts predict it could create momentum towards the upper resistance line of the channel, potentially pushing Bitcoin’s price to the range of $110,000 to $112,000.

While there may be speculative optimism about a potential recovery, not all analysts share this positive view. Titan of Crypto cautions that the bearish pressures could intensify, suggesting that Bitcoin might still face further declines that could see it testing the $87,000 mark next. This viewpoint contemplates a scenario where deeper price lows could invoke “maximum pain” for both short and long-term holders—a stark reminder of the inherent risks surrounding cryptocurrency investments.

However, Titan of Crypto also introduces a silver lining in this bearish outlook—a possibility that the impending decline could ultimately set the stage for a significant price rally. This paradox reflects a recurring theme in cryptocurrency trading: the expectation of sharp corrections frequently precedes new bullish trends.
